Nurkholis Hidayat, SH., LL.M

Founder and Managing Partner

Nurkholis Hidayat commenced his legal practice in 2004, member of Indonesia Bar Association, founder of Southeast Asia Legal Aid Lawyers (SEALAW) Network, and previously served as a director of the Jakarta Legal Aid Institute (LBH Jakarta-YLBHI), and National Advisor for Legal Aid and Criminal Justice Reform for the Australia Indonesia Partnership for Justice (AIPJ). More recently, he serves as a member of CSO representative for the Indonesian Multi-Stakeholder Group of the Extractive International Transparency Initiative (EITI). He also serves as a researcher at the Indonesian Tax Justice Network and Responsibank Coalition.

Nurkholis holds a master of laws from the Melbourne Law School, the University of Melbourne and has a bachelor degree from the University of Sebelas Maret, Surakarta. He is a fellow of Fredkorpset-Norwey South to South Exchange Program in 2008, Fellow of the US -International Visitor Leadership Program (IVLP) -The Rule of Law Program in 2013, awardee of Australia Award Scholarship in 2015. His area of expertise covers business and human rights, environmental social governance, legal aid, criminal justice and anti-corruption (e.g, tax avoidance and evasion, and illicit financial flows). His views on legal and human rights issues are frequently published in national newspapers.
